Ceiling Panel Repair in Boulder, CO
Ceiling panel repair services address issues related to damaged, stained, or sagging ceiling tiles and panels in residential properties. This service covers a variety of projects, including replacing broken or water-damaged panels, fixing sagging sections, and restoring the appearance of ceilings in areas such as kitchens, basements, or office spaces. Property owners often want to understand the types of ceiling materials involved, the causes of damage, and the best options for repair or replacement to ensure a durable and visually appealing result.
Before requesting ceiling panel repair, homeowners should consider the extent of the damage, whether it is localized or widespread, and any underlying issues such as leaks or structural problems that may need addressing first. It is also helpful to know the specific type of ceiling panels installed, such as acoustic tiles or drop ceiling tiles, to determine the most appropriate repair approach. Clear information about the project's scope can help ensure the repair process is efficient and results in a long-lasting, attractive ceiling.

Ceiling Panel Repair Questions
What causes ceiling panels to need repair? Damage from water leaks, impacts, or age can cause ceiling panels to crack, sag, or become stained.
What types of ceiling panel repairs are common? Repairs often include replacing damaged panels, fixing sagging sections, or addressing water stains and discoloration.
Can ceiling panels be repaired without replacing the entire ceiling? Yes, many issues can be resolved by replacing or patching individual panels without full ceiling replacement.
What should property owners consider before repairing ceiling panels? It's important to identify the underlying cause of damage to ensure proper repair and prevent future issues.
